About this Product

Designed by Gabriel Ordeig Cole and Nina Masó for Santa & Cole in 1986, La Bella Durmiente is a sculpture of light that feels both timeless and gently alive. Its tall, slender profile balances a luminous orb atop a slender stem, evoking a tranquil sentinel that watches over quiet evenings. The lamp’s warm glow and elegant proportions transform ordinary corners into serene spaces, while its bold silhouette nods to modernist simplicity with a poetic Spanish soul. It’s not just lighting — it’s a quiet companion that whispers character into any room.

About the Designer

Gabriel Ordeig Cole is a Spanish designer and editor whose work moves fluidly between design culture, publishing, and object creation. Closely linked to Santa & Cole, he has played a key role in shaping its intellectual and editorial identity, promoting a vision of design rooted in culture, storytelling, and everyday use rather than pure form-making. His approach favors clarity, warmth, and reflection, treating design as a medium for ideas and atmosphere, where objects are valued as much for the life they accompany as for their appearance.
